Alim Mirza Ladha, MD, Neurological Surgery

8050 E Hwy 191
Ste 203
OdessaTX  79765-8615 (Ector County)


Phone: 432-617-4551
Fax: 432-687-6298

NPI: 1093935975
License Number: P0750 (TX)